Vraag 2 Verslag
Lake Kivu and Malawi are related in that they_________
Antwoorddetails
Lake Kivu and Lake Malawi are related in that they are both rift valley lakes. A rift valley lake is a type of lake that forms in a depression or basin created by tectonic activity. In the case of these two lakes, they were formed as a result of the East African Rift, which is a large geological rift that stretches for thousands of kilometers through Eastern Africa. The two lakes are located in different parts of the rift, with Lake Kivu in the western branch and Lake Malawi in the southern branch, but they share a common geological origin.

In which of the following rock types is petroleum mainly found?
Antwoorddetails
Petroleum is mainly found in sedimentary rocks. Sedimentary rocks are formed from the accumulation and cementation of sediments, which can include organic matter such as dead plants and animals. Over time, this organic matter can become buried and subjected to heat and pressure, which can transform it into petroleum through a process called diagenesis. Petroleum is a fossil fuel that is composed of hydrocarbons, which are molecules made up of carbon and hydrogen atoms. The organic matter in sedimentary rocks that forms petroleum is usually derived from marine plants and animals that died and sank to the bottom of the ocean. Over time, these organic remains can be buried by layers of sediment, and the heat and pressure from the overlying rocks can cause them to be transformed into petroleum. While it is possible for petroleum to be found in other types of rocks, such as metamorphic rocks that have undergone extreme heat and pressure, sedimentary rocks are by far the most common type of rock that contains petroleum. This is because the process of petroleum formation requires the accumulation and burial of organic matter, which is most likely to occur in sedimentary environments such as oceans, lakes, and swamps.

Vraag 17 Verslag
Study the table given which shows the mean climatic conditions of station Q and answer the questions.
| Month | J | F | M | A | M | J | J | A | S | O | N | D | |
| Temp(°C) | -11 | -9 | 4 | 3 | 12 | 17 | 19 | 17 | 11 | 4 | -2 | -8 | |
| Precipitation(mm) | 28 | 23 | 30 | 38 | 48 | 51 | 71 | 74 | 56 | 36 | 41 | 41 | |
| The annual temperature range at the station is | |||||||||||||
Antwoorddetails
The annual temperature range at station Q is calculated as the difference between the highest and the lowest temperature recorded in a year. The highest temperature recorded at the station in the given table is 19°C and the lowest temperature recorded is -11°C. Hence, the annual temperature range at the station Q is 19°C - (-11°C) = 30°C. So, the answer is 30°C.

Vraag 27 Verslag
A river transport its load through the following processes except_________
Antwoorddetails
The river transports its load through three main processes: solution, traction, and suspension. Plucking is not a process by which a river transports its load. Solution is the process by which the river dissolves soluble minerals such as calcium and transports them in solution. Traction is the process by which larger and heavier particles such as boulders and pebbles are rolled or dragged along the riverbed. Suspension is the process by which smaller and lighter particles such as silt and clay are carried along in the flowing water. Plucking, on the other hand, is a process by which glaciers transport their load. It occurs when the glacier freezes onto rocks and then plucks them out as the glacier moves. This process is not applicable to rivers as they do not have the capability to freeze onto rocks and pluck them out.

Vraag 33 Verslag
A mercury barometer is used for measuring_________
Antwoorddetails
A mercury barometer is used for measuring atmospheric pressure. Atmospheric pressure is the force exerted by the weight of air molecules in the atmosphere. It is an important parameter that affects weather patterns and other natural phenomena. A mercury barometer consists of a long glass tube filled with mercury and inverted into a dish of mercury. The mercury in the tube rises or falls depending on the atmospheric pressure. When the atmospheric pressure is high, the weight of the air above the barometer pushes down on the surface of the mercury in the dish, forcing the mercury in the tube to rise. Conversely, when the atmospheric pressure is low, the weight of the air above the barometer is less, and the mercury in the tube falls. By measuring the height of the mercury column in the tube, the atmospheric pressure can be determined. The standard unit of atmospheric pressure is the Pascal (Pa), but barometric pressure is often measured in units of millimeters of mercury (mmHg) or inches of mercury (inHg). In summary, a mercury barometer is a device used to measure atmospheric pressure by observing the height of a column of mercury in a glass tube.

Vraag 35 Verslag
Which of the following rocks is composed of the skeletons of microscopic sea plants and animals?
Antwoorddetails
The rock composed of the skeletons of microscopic sea plants and animals is called "Chalk". Chalk is a soft, white, porous sedimentary rock that is formed from the remains of tiny marine organisms called coccolithophores. These microscopic creatures have hard shells made of calcium carbonate, and when they die, their shells accumulate on the ocean floor. Over time, these accumulations can become compressed and cemented together, forming the soft rock we know as chalk. Chalk is often found in areas that were once covered by shallow seas, such as in the cliffs of southern England. It has many uses, including as a writing surface, in construction, and as a natural fertilizer. Its softness and white color also make it a popular material for art, such as in the creation of chalk drawings.

Vraag 37 Verslag
Lines joining places of equal sunshine duration on maps are__________
Antwoorddetails
The lines joining places of equal sunshine duration on maps are called Isohel. Isohel is a type of contour line that connects all the points on a map that receive the same amount of sunlight in a given period, usually a day or a year. These lines are similar to contour lines on a topographic map that connect points of equal elevation. Isohels are used to show areas with similar amounts of sunshine and can be used to analyze patterns in climate and weather. For example, isohel maps can help identify areas with higher or lower amounts of sunlight and help to plan agriculture, solar power generation, and other activities that depend on sunlight.
